Afternoon all,
My friend is in the process of booking a 'stag-do' in Krakow for next May and I was wandering the best technique for arranging such an event so that we don't get totally ripped off!?
So far we've pretty much typed in 'stag do krakow' into google and then gone through a few British firms that arrange such things, however i have a funny feeling that there will be a big slice for these middlemen.
Has anyone ever booked through this type of company? Are the hotels OK? I'm expecting a little YMCA type hotel as i can't see your average hotel wanting to accomodate a stag do!
Also, my friend is quite anxious to book a few activities through these websites who insist that we need to book it now to avoid disappointment. I think they're 'BS ing' us as I believe that we will get the same events for half the price if we sort them ourselves when we're in Poland?
Has anyone got any advice to give?

I went in May this year - not a stag do but 6 lads together.
I the booked flight with Stelios's lot and the hotel via last minute.com. Had a very pleasant 4 days - wonderful city, excellent bars (especially the cellar bars) , beautiful women. Top drawer.
I stayed just outside the city at Hotel Chopin (cheaper on last minute than booking direct with hotel on their website) - a short tram ride from the main square. Decent breakfast included in the price. It's a decent 3 star type place - a bit dated but not bad overall.
Think I paid about £70 for the return flight and £110 for 3 nights B&B at the hotel.
As far as activities go I can't really comment as we just wandered around the city seeing stuff rather than paintballing or any of that malarky. However, I strongly recommend you go to Aushwitz and Birkenau - might seem a bit "heavy" for a stag do but I think it is essential. You can go on bus, train or just stand still in the main square and a tour guide will offer to give you an organised trip.
